US Rail Unions Assess Union Pacificnorfolk Southern Merger

The proposed $85 billion merger between Union Pacific and Norfolk Southern has sparked controversy within US railroad unions. BLET and BMWED, representing over half of unionized employees, state that most members oppose the merger, fearing layoffs, wage reductions, and other negative impacts. The unions are calling for the protection of employee rights and urging regulators to conduct a thorough assessment of the merger's potential consequences. They emphasize the need for guarantees safeguarding workers' interests in any final agreement.

US Services Sector Growth Hits Near Oneyear High in February

The U.S. ISM Non-Manufacturing NMI index surged to 59.7 in February, a near one-year high, marking the 109th consecutive month of growth. This data, released by the Institute for Supply Management (ISM), signals a robust expansion in U.S. non-manufacturing activity. This positive trend may alleviate concerns about a potential economic slowdown and provide sustained momentum for the overall economy. The significant increase suggests continued strength in the services sector, a key driver of U.S. economic growth.

Kansas City Southern Digitizes Crossborder Logistics Via Commtrex

Kansas City Southern (KCS) partnered with Commtrex to enhance the visibility and accessibility of transload services through a digital platform, optimizing US-Mexico freight transportation. This initiative helps shippers find transload facilities, fostering growth in the Mexican market, particularly benefiting the automotive industry. KCS's digital strategy strengthens its competitiveness in the North American rail transport market, signaling a smarter future for the industry. The collaboration aims to streamline operations and improve efficiency for customers involved in cross-border trade.
